Move to E10 fuel 'shouldn't be underestimated' - Mercedes

Mercedes believe that of all the changes being made to Formula 1's technical regulations, the move to E10 fuel will be one of the biggest transitions in the short history of the sport's hybrid era. The switch is part of the sport's commitment to being more environmentally friendly in future, with the ultimate aim of having a net zero carbon footprint by 2030. Last year cars ran on E5 fuel, which consisted of five per cent ethanol and 95 per cent traditional fossil fuels. This year the amount of sustainable ethanol in the blend will double to ten per cent.
